Understanding ChatGPT and Perplexity AI
ChatGPT, developed by OpenAI, is based on the GPT (Generative Pre-trained Transformer) architecture. It is trained on vast datasets to generate human-like text responses. Evaluating Perplexity AI
Perplexity AI measures how uncertain a language model is when predicting text. Lower perplexity indicates higher confidence and generally correlates with better accuracy. However, perplexity alone does not guarantee correctness, as models can be confidently wrong.
Reliability in Practical Use
In practical applications, both ChatGPT and Perplexity AI show strengths and weaknesses. They excel in generating ideas, drafting content, and answering general questions. However, for critical tasks like medical advice or legal consulting, their outputs should be verified by experts.
